Abstract

The 1U rack mount equipment enclosure with increased structural support, supports internal components without adding to the over all height of the 1U form factor. The peripheral device is mounted between front supports which bear the weight of the peripheral device. A central support provides support necessary to prevent deflection of the front supports. Rear supports between the central support and the rear side provide support to prevent the central support from bending due to the force placed on the central support by the front supports.

Claims (40)

1. A one and three-quarter inch form factor rack mountable equipment enclosure comprising:

a bottom cover having a right sidewall, a left sidewall and a rear sidewall extending perpendicularly upward from said bottom cover;

a central support beam parallel to said rear wall and connected to said right sidewall, said left sidewall, and said bottom cover;

a front support cantilevered from said central support extending to a front plane of said equipment enclosure;

a means for rigidly attaching said front support to said central support beam and said bottom cover;

a rear support between said central support beam and said rear wall;

a means for connecting said rear support to said bottom cover, said central support beam and said rear sidewall; and

a top cover for enclosing top of said equipment enclosure.

2. The equipment enclosure of claim 1 wherein said front support further comprises:

a right and left mounting tab extending perpendicular from a center section of said front support for attaching said front support to said central support beam; and

a right and left mounting tab extending outward from a top side of said front support for attaching said front support to said central support beam to increase rigidity between said central support beam and said front support.
